Main Responsibilities
Main client contacts and project lead on major projects.
Manage delivery of projects through liaison with clients, design team, external consultants and in-house resources.
Allocate appropriate resource to deliver projects in time and within budget.
Deliver on client expectations through highest quality delivery and commercial management.
Provide highest quality oral and written advice based on client’s scope / commercial requirements as well as an informed understanding of client needs.
Ability to undertake or direct site research, photos, VOA, land registry – make informed decisions regarding level of due diligence required based on the developing risk-profile of each project.
Review legal documents / deeds etc giving appropriately caveated opinions and deferring to legal advisors where appropriate
Delegate tasks internally and liaise with colleagues to ensure appropriate resource allocation and delivery in-line with both programme and cost targets.
Advising on appropriate mitigation strategy considering holistic ‘risk-profile’ from both a planning and RoL perspective (e.g. age of neighbours, use, presence of deeds, planning risks, views of neighbours and stakeholders).
